To find the number of wins by race car drivers in UMP (United Midwestern Promoters) dirt track racing, you can visit the official UMP website or their social media pages, where they often post statistics and race results. Additionally, racing databases and forums dedicated to dirt track racing may provide detailed statistics on drivers' wins. Checking race results from specific events or the season standings can also help you track individual driver performances.

The Preakness is held at Pimlico Race Course in Baltimore, Maryland. The track is a 1-mile dirt oval. The race itself is a mile and 3/16.
